Overview
AD7888ARUZ-REEL from Analog Devices is a micropower, 12-bit, 8-channel successive-approximation ADC operating from a single 2.7 V to 5.25 V supply, delivering 125 kSPS throughput with 500 ns track/hold acquisition time and integrated 2.5 V reference. It supports SPI/QSPI/MICROWIRE/DSP-compatible serial interface and targets battery-powered instrumentation and portable medical devices.
For engineers reviewing the AD7888ARUZ-REEL datasheet, AD7888ARUZ-REEL pinout, AD7888ARUZ-REEL application, or AD7888ARUZ-REEL equivalent, key selection criteria include guaranteed 12-bit no-missed-codes performance (B-grade), channel-to-channel isolation of –80 dB at 25 kHz, flexible power management (shutdown current ≤1 µA at 2.7–3.6 V), and TSSOP-16 package compatibility with space-constrained embedded systems.
Technical Context
The AD7888ARUZ-REEL implements a charge redistribution SAR architecture with internal track-and-hold, enabling full-power signal conversion up to 2.5 MHz. Its 8-channel single-ended multiplexer is controlled via an 8-bit write-only control register with ADD0–ADD2 address bits and REF/PM1/PM0 configuration bits.
It features dual reference operation: internal 2.5 V reference (±50 ppm/°C tempco, 2.45–2.55 V output) or external reference (1.2 V to VDD), with high-impedance REF IN/REF OUT pin (5 kΩ when enabled, >1 GΩ when disabled). Serial interface timing requires 16 SCLK cycles per conversion (14.5 for conversion + 1.5 for acquisition) with CS framing and MSB-first 16-bit data stream (4 leading zeros + 12-bit result).
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Resolution | 12-bit - delivers 4096 discrete digital codes with straight binary output |
| Throughput Rate | 125 kSPS - enables real-time sampling of signals up to 2.5 MHz full-power bandwidth |
| Supply Voltage | 2.7 V to 5.25 V - supports both 3 V and 5 V system rails without level-shifting |
| Reference Options | Internal 2.5 V ±50 ppm/°C or external 1.2 V to VDD - allows precision calibration or system-level reference sharing |
| Shutdown Current | 1 µA max at 2.7–3.6 V - extends battery life in intermittent-sampling applications |
| SNR / THD | 71 dB / –80 dB typ at 10 kHz - meets requirements for medium-fidelity sensor digitization |
| Channel Isolation | –80 dB at 25 kHz - prevents crosstalk between adjacent analog inputs in multi-sensor systems |
Pinout & Package
AD7888ARUZ-REEL is housed in a 16-lead Thin Shrink Small Outline Package (TSSOP), 4.4 mm × 5.0 mm × 1.2 mm body size, with 0.65 mm lead pitch and exposed pad (not electrically connected). Pin 1 is marked by a dot or beveled corner.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1 (CS) | Chip Select | Active-low frame sync for serial transfers; initiates conversion on falling edge |
| 2 (REF IN/REF OUT) | Reference I/O | Provides access to internal 2.5 V reference or accepts external 1.2–VDD reference |
| 3 (VDD) | Power Supply | Single 2.7–5.25 V rail powering analog and digital circuitry |
| 4, 13 (AGND) | Analog Ground | Dual low-impedance return path for analog inputs, reference, and internal circuitry |
| 5–12 (AIN1–AIN8) | Analog Inputs | Eight single-ended channels, each 0–VREF range; unused pins must tie to AGND |
| 14 (DIN) | Data Input | Loads 8-bit control register on SCLK rising edges (MSB first) |
| 15 (DOUT) | Data Output | Serial 16-bit stream (4 zeros + 12-bit result) clocked on SCLK falling edge |
| 16 (SCLK) | Serial Clock | Master clock for control register writes, conversion timing, and data transfer (2 MHz max) |
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| Flexible Power Management | Four modes (Normal/Autoshutdown/Autostandby/Full Shutdown) programmable via PM1/PM0 bits |
| Guaranteed No-Missed-Codes | 12-bit monotonicity ensured across full temperature range (–40°C to +105°C, B-grade) |
| Low-Power Track-and-Hold | 500 ns acquisition time with 38 pF input capacitance in track mode, 4 pF in hold mode |
| Versatile Serial Interface | SPI/QSPI/MICROWIRE/DSP-compatible protocol with CS framing and 16-cycle transaction |
| On-Chip Reference Buffer | 2.5 V ±50 ppm/°C reference with 5 kΩ input impedance when enabled; >1 GΩ when disabled |

FAQ
What is the guaranteed no-missed-codes performance of the AD7888ARUZ-REEL?
The AD7888ARUZ-REEL is a B-grade device with guaranteed no-missed-codes performance across its full 12-bit range (0 to 4095) over the operating temperature range of –40°C to +105°C. This is confirmed in the DC accuracy specifications table, where differential nonlinearity is specified as –1/+1.5 LSB max, ensuring monotonic behavior and absence of code gaps under all valid operating conditions for the AD7888ARUZ-REEL.
Does the AD7888ARUZ-REEL support external reference voltages, and what is the acceptable range?
Yes, the AD7888ARUZ-REEL supports external reference voltages applied to the REF IN/REF OUT pin. The valid range is 1.2 V to VDD, where VDD is between 2.7 V and 5.25 V. When an external reference is used, the internal 2.5 V reference must be disabled by setting the REF bit in the control register to ensure optimal performance and avoid contention. This capability allows system-level reference sharing and improved absolute accuracy in the AD7888ARUZ-REEL.
What are the power management modes available on the AD7888ARUZ-REEL, and how are they configured?
The AD7888ARUZ-REEL offers four power management modes: Normal Operation (PM1=0, PM0=0), Full Shutdown (PM1=0, PM0=1), Autoshutdown (PM1=1, PM0=0), and Autostandby (PM1=1, PM0=1). These are set via bits PM1 and PM0 in the 8-bit control register, loaded on the DIN pin during the first 8 SCLK rising edges after CS assertion. Autoshutdown reduces current to ≤1 µA at 2.7–3.6 V with 5 µs wake-up, making it ideal for duty-cycled sensing in the AD7888ARUZ-REEL.
How does the AD7888ARUZ-REEL handle analog input channel selection?
The AD7888ARUZ-REEL selects among its eight single-ended analog inputs (AIN1–AIN8) using the ADD2, ADD1, and ADD0 bits in the control register. These three address bits decode to one of eight channels per Table II in the datasheet (e.g., 000 = AIN1, 111 = AIN8). The selected channel is converted on the next conversion cycle after the register is loaded. On power-up, the default is AIN1; returning from shutdown retains the last-selected channel - a deterministic behavior critical for reliable sequencing in the AD7888ARUZ-REEL.
What is the serial interface timing requirement for achieving 125 kSPS throughput with the AD7888ARUZ-REEL?
To achieve 125 kSPS throughput, the AD7888ARUZ-REEL requires a 2 MHz SCLK frequency, as specified in the timing characteristics table. Each conversion consumes exactly 16 SCLK cycles: 14.5 for conversion and 1.5 for track/hold acquisition. With CS asserted, the full 16-cycle transaction (including control register load and 16-bit data read) completes in 8 µs, enabling the maximum sustained rate. Timing parameters such as t1 (CS-to-SCLK setup) and t3 (data access time) must also be met - all verified across –40°C to +105°C for the AD7888ARUZ-REEL.
